Summary:The paper deals with the investigation of the temporal instabilities and spatial localization due to the L�ders behavior and the PortevinLe Chatelier effect in the carbon steel C1010 and the aluminummagnesium alloy AA5052, which manifest the unstable plastic flow. The digital image correlation technique and the infrared thermography were used to capture and study the processes of the initiation and propagation of the deformation bands. The main part of the research focuses on the estimation of the influence of the loading systems stiffness on the irregular plastic flow, which was carried out on flat specimens with complicated geometry and on specimens with additional deformable parts
